EtherTalk (AppleTalk) Configuration
The EtherTalk Protocol enables computer to printer communications over the EtherTalk (AppleTalk)
network.
Changing EtherTalk Settings at the Printer
1. Press the
Log In/Out
button on the control panel.
2. Enter the
System Administrator’s Login ID
and
Passcode
if prompted (default
admin
,
1111
), and
press
Enter
.
3. Press the
Machine Status
button.
4. Touch the
Tools
tab.
5. Press
Connectivity & Network Setup
.
6. Press
Port Settings
.
7. Press the
EtherTalk
selection line on the Port Settings menu.
8. Press the
Change Settings
button in the lower right corner of the Port Settings menu screen.
9. When the EtherTalk selection menu displays, note that you have only one selection available on a
single, numbered horizontal line, with the current status of this setting shown. The
Close
button in
the upper right corner of the screen returns you to the Port Settings menu. After pressing the
horizontal line selection, to access available settings press the
Change Settings
button in the lower
right corner of the touch screen.
Port Status (EtherTalk Enablement)
1. On the EtherTalk selection menu, press the selection line labeled
Port Status
.
2. Press the
Change Settings
button.
3. On the Port Status screen, note which of the two buttons is highlighted as the current setting for
EtherTalk Enablement. The available settings are Enabled or Disabled. To print with EtherTalk, this
setting must be
Enabled
.
4. To change settings, press your setting of choice, then press the
Save
button.
5. To exit the screen, without making any changes, press the
Cancel
button.
Exiting the EtherTalk Selection Menu
To exit the EtherTalk selection menu, which returns you to the Port Settings menu, press the
Close
button in the upper right corner of the touch screen.
